概括
由于机器的变化,启动Reflexion X1线性加速器 (linac) 和处理计划系统 (TPS) 需要特定的站点光束模型. 开发了一种标准化的方法,但共识模型还不是确保精确的辐射治疗的理想选择.
科学领域:
- 医学物理 医学物理
- 辐射瘤学 辐射瘤学
- 放射治疗技术 放射治疗技术
背景情况:
- 确保像Reflexion X1线性加速器 (linac) 这样的新系统的精确辐射传递需要强大的调试.
- 最初的装置提供了数据,以开发一致的光束模型调试方法.
研究的目的:
- 为RefleXion X1 linac和治疗计划系统 (TPS) 建立参考调试,质量保证 (QA) 和质量控制 (QC) 数据.
主要方法:
- 比较了来自七台RefleXion X1联机的光束测量和TPS数据.
- 优化的光束模型使用静态和动态光束几何测量在各种幻影.
- 从各个机构的标准化治疗计划生成并比较测量剂量.
主要成果:
- 静态光束数据 (百分比深度剂量,配置文件,输出因子) 显示出良好的一致性 (<2%的线路间差异).
- 观察到纵向场宽度和光束中心的显著差异.
- 治疗规划和交付显示出差异,需要独特的,特定于地点的光束模型优化.
结论:
- 建立了一个系统的方法来调试和验证Reflexion.
- 机构间的差异表明,目前需要个别的,特定地点的光束模型.
- 在安装时改进的质量控制可以在未来实现共识参考数据集.
